More about IWaata

Overview of Dancehall musician IWaata

IWaata is a Jamaican reggae and dancehall musician who has gained attention for his distinctive sound, which combines traditional reggae beats with contemporary dancehall rhythms. IWaata has become well-known in Jamaica and elsewhere thanks to his beautiful voice and fascinating lyrics.

IWaata, who was born and bred in Jamaica, began his musical career at an early age by playing at gatherings and parties in his community. His ability to connect with his audience and produce powerful voices rapidly earned him acclaim. IWaata started experimenting with other musical genres as he developed his abilities, fusing parts of reggae, dancehall, and R&B to produce his own distinctive sound.

IWaata is now renowned for his contagious sounds and lyrical lyrics that discuss the challenges and victories of daily life. IWaata offers an unrivaled level of fire and emotion to his music, whether he's recording or playing live. IWaata is positioned to become one of the most well-known figures in reggae and dancehall music for years to come thanks to his expanding fan base and indisputable talent.

What are the most popular songs for Dancehall musician IWaata?

IWaata, a Jamaican reggae and dancehall performer, has a number of well-known songs that have won over admirers all over the world. He is well known for the songs "Clip Tall," "Yeng Bounce," "Thick Thick," "Whisper," "Ghost Town," "Outaada," "Detta Play," "Beach Shorts," "Bou Yah," and "Pull It." Each song stands out from the others due to its distinctive tempo and lyrics.

With its catchy and cheerful tune that inspires you to dance, "Yeng Bounce" is one of IWaata's most well-known songs. The song is about a girl who he likes because of her distinct style and attitude. "Thick Thick," another fan favorite, is ideal for a romantic evening because to its seductive lyrics and slower tempo.

Another well-known song that highlights IWaata's storytelling abilities is "Clip Tall". The song is about a man who struggles with life on a daily basis but finds comfort in music. Other songs, including "Ghost Town" and "Detta Play," are more politically charged and focus on the difficulties of life in inner-city Jamaica.

IWaata has a variety of well-known songs that demonstrate his flexibility as a musician. IWaata offers a song for everyone, whether you're in the mood for a love song or a political message.

Which are the most important collaborations with other musicians for Dancehall musician IWaata?

IWaata, a Jamaican reggae and dancehall musician, has worked with other musicians on some notable projects. The songs "Pain" with Terro Don, "Nine Night" with Damage Musiq, "Sterling" with Weekday, "Gyal Operation" also with Weekday, and "One Time" with DJ MIMI are a few examples of these collaborations.

The "Pain" duet with Terro Don is one of the most memorable ones. The song, a traditional dancehall number, highlights IWaata's lyrical talent. The tune gains even more complexity as a result of the collaboration with Terro Don, who is renowned for his distinctive approach. The song is a notable hit because of its catchy beat and the performers' vocals. Fans have responded well to the song, which demonstrates IWaata's capacity for working with various musicians.
